Video Optimization

Videos are slowly becoming more popular as a medium through which information is shared on the internet. Whether it’s in the form of a video background or a video that’s incorporated into how you’re able to introduce your website to a visitor, videos are quickly becoming a rich traffic magnet to those who are able to utilize them properly. This also helps greatly if a site is going to pass the “blink test”.

An Emphasis On Voice Search

Spoken queries are predicted to become more popular as we progress further in the development of smart assistants. With Apple’s Siri, Samsung’s Bixby, Amazon’s Alexa, and of course, Google’s Google Assistant already on the market, we are also becoming more attuned to their use. Much like the way that cars have replaced horse-drawn carriages back in the day, voice search seems poised to replace keyboard typing.

Mobile-First Indexing

The way and the frequency at which we interact with our mobile devices seems to get more pronounced with each passing year. Google is aware of this trend, and while mobile-first indexing isn’t necessarily new, it’s going to be one vital aspect of website ownership in the years to come, given that it’s been found that about 80{b96076133fe2223c8d05470fe9428b3312879515b4c32f98bade61cbd4879fe1} of searches are currently done through a mobile device. Artificial Intelligence

One of the biggest buzzwords of 2018 is predicted to become a mainstay in the coming year. In fact, Google already uses artificial intelligence in how its search engine functions. A Google AI called RankBrain is used to perform more specific inquiries in conjunction with the conventional search algorithm. With Google being at the forefront of the technology, you shouldn’t be surprised when AI becomes more commonplace.
